Investigators writing in the Journal of Early Adolescence were interested in the communication about sex and related topics between parents and 12-14 year olds. The investigators asked students and parents whether or not they had communicated with their child/parent about topics such as pregnancy, how to say "no," and methods of contraception. A scatter plot of their data is presented below. Each point represents one topic listed by the investigators. For example, 72.4% of parents and 57.6% of adolescents said the parents had discussed childbirth. This would be recorded as the point (57.6, 72.4). (a)On the graph above, sketch the line y = x, representing a line of  perfect agreement  between the parents and adolescents. (b)What explanation do you have for the placement of the points in the scatter plot relative to the line you sketched in part (a)?
